Australian bowlers didn't have that bad a game, the Windies' batting was exceptional. The Aussies' death bowling was impressive, though. Mitchell Owen, Nathan Ellis and Adam Zampa took one apiece. Now, it all comes down to whether the Windies can defend this total or if the Aussies will chase it down to seal the series.
The Windies openers, Shai Hope and Brandon King, got off to a flying start, smashing 66 runs in the first six overs without losing a wicket. Hope was particularly dominant, scoring 43 of those runs. Although King fell at 125, Hope continued his onslaught and went on to score his maiden T20I century. The Windies batters took full advantage of the short boundaries to post a massive total.
The West Indies batting unit has finally found its rhythm, posting an imposing total of 214Â runs on the board.

PITCH REPORT - Samuel Badree is in for a chat. He says he wouldnât want to be a bowler on this wicket and informs that the average winning first-innings score here since 2022 is 205. He points out that one of the key reasons for such high scores is the boundary dimensions. Mentions that the square boundaries measure 61 and 65 meters, with the straight hit being 68 metres. Australian captain Mitchell Marsh informs that his team would bowl first, citing the small ground and strong breeze as key factors. He believes these conditions will give his bowling unit an advantage and hopes they can restrict the opposition to a reasonable total. Marsh described the ground as the smallest he's seen in world cricket, predicting that the ball will travel quickly. He emphasized that the team is looking to improve and will stick to their plans.
